Sidhu released from Patiala jail

The former BJP MP, sentenced to three-year imprisonment in a road rage case, is out after two nights in prison.

After spending two nights in jail, cricketer-turned-politician Navjot Singh Sidhu, sentenced to three years imprisonment in a road rage case, was released on Saturday on bail granted by the Supreme Court.

Sidhu, also a maverick cricket commentator, was greeted by a number of BJP and SAD workers led by local MLA Surjit Singh Rakhra when he emerged out of the jail.

The BJP's former Amritsar MP and his friend Rupinder Singh Sandhu were released from the prison this afternoon, a day after they secured bail from the Supreme Court.

Though the Supreme Court granted him bail on Friday, he could not be released on Friday itself as the orders reached Patiala prisons late on Friday evening.

Sidhu and Sandhu had surrendered before the Chief Judicial Magistrate in Chandigarh and were sent to the Patiala jail on Thursday and had moved the apex court for bail.

The duo was sentenced to three-year rigorous imprisonment for causing death of Patiala resident Gurnam Singh during a scuffle following an accident.
